Building Energy Management Systems (BEMS) surveys are being promoted as a key method for improving energy efficiency in buildings. JRP Solutions offers a comprehensive six-step process to optimize BEMS, starting with a detailed audit and ending with measurable
impacts such as lower energy bills and reduced carbon footprints. The surveys identify inefficiencies in control strategies, sensor placements, and maintenance practices, offering solutions that can save up to 40% of a building's energy use.
Why It's Important?
Buildings account for a significant portion of global energy use and CO2 emissions. Optimizing BEMS can lead to substantial energy savings and environmental benefits, supporting sustainability goals and reducing operational costs. This is particularly relevant as businesses and governments strive to meet climate targets and improve energy efficiency.
